As global decarbonization ambitions collide with real-world economics, compressed natural gas (CNG) is quietly reasserting itself as a pragmatic, low-emission solution for heavy-duty trucking.
Amid rising diesel costs, tightening emissions rules and infrastructure and economic constraints that continue to slow electric and hydrogen adoption, fleets across North America are revisiting CNG as a proven, immediately deployable technology; and the companies enabling its performance and efficiency through innovation are emerging as key beneficiaries.
CNG-powered trucks have always been part of the alternative fuel landscape, but their economic and environmental profile is gaining new relevance. Diesel’s price volatility and evolving emissions regulations have made cost predictability a strategic advantage. According to the US Energy Information Administration, retail natural gas fuel prices have remained consistently 50 to 60 percent below diesel prices since 2015, and it’s forecast to continue through 2026.
Proven alternative
CNG’s stability is already translating into renewed fleet interest.
In its analysis on alternative fuels, the North American Council for Freight Efficiency notes that natural gas remains the most proven and scalable low-emission fuel for heavy-duty applications, offering a credible path to lower total cost of ownership while meeting sustainability goals. “These big rigs travel an average of 400 to 600 miles per day and require strong pulling power. CNG and LNG have proven to be the best alternatives to diesel for these trucks, meeting their required range and performance criteria while burning cleaner than diesel,” the council states.
Recent market analyses reinforce this trend: Data from Global Growth Insights show the global CNG heavy-duty truck market is projected to expand from US$7.1 billion in 2024 to nearly US$12 billion by 2033, a compound annual growth rate of 5.7 percent, driven largely by fleet conversions and new OEM integrations.
Innovation is key
CNG offers fleets an appealing blend of cost efficiency, regulatory compliance and operational familiarity. Unlike battery electric or hydrogen systems, CNG relies on existing fueling infrastructure and mature vehicle technology. According to the US Department of Energy’s Alternative Fuels Data Center, CNG engines cut greenhouse gas emissions by 15 to 25 percent compared to diesel, and can deliver additional air-quality benefits through lower nitrogen oxide and particulate output.
The latest CNG systems also deliver performance that was once reserved for diesel.
